About St Patrick's Church
Inside, there's some decent stained glass work and the kind of calm that only old churches seem to manage. The architecture tells the story of 19th-century craftsmanship without being showy about it. You're looking at maybe twenty minutes here unless you're into a deep dive on ecclesiastical history, in which case the details reward closer inspection.
This works best if you're already in Ballymena for the day rather than planning a trip specifically around it. Honestly? It's a solid quiet moment in your itinerary rather than a destination in itself. Perfect if you're cycling through Mid and East Antrim and want somewhere peaceful to stop and stretch your legs. The surrounding area has proper countryside walking if you want to extend the visit beyond the church itself.
